Advanced Manufacturing in Whanganui

Advanced manufacturing is one of Whanganui’s defining economic strengths and a key driver of the district’s export economy. The sector combines deep engineering capability with practical innovation, enabling businesses to design, manufacture, and deliver high-value products to national and international markets.


Manufacturers in Whanganui operate across engineering, machinery and equipment, fabricated metals, plastics, marine manufacturing, specialist materials, and precision production. Many businesses operate in specialised global niches, producing technically sophisticated products that compete successfully well beyond New Zealand.

This capability has been built over decades and continues to evolve as firms invest in new technology, automation, and product development.


Whanganui offers manufacturers room to grow. Available industrial land, supportive infrastructure, and a connected business environment make the district an attractive location for companies looking to expand or establish new operations.

$1.1b

Annual manufacturing exports

$261.2m

Annual contribution to GDP

2,673

Local manufacturing jobs filled
